Integrating Ethics into Computer Science Education: Multi-, Inter-, and Transdisciplinary Approaches

Integrating Ethics into Computer Science Education: Multi-, Inter-, and Transdisciplinary Approaches
Jared O'Leary

In this episode I unpack Goetze’s (2023) publication titled “Integrating ethics into computer science education: Multi-, inter-, and transdisciplinary approaches,” which unpacks three approaches to integrating ethics with computer science education.

Article

Goetze, T., (2023). Integrating Ethics into Computer Science Education: Multi-, Inter-, and Transdisciplinary Approaches. Proceedings of the 2023 ACM SIGCSE Technical Symposium on Computer Science Education - SIGCSE ’23, 645-651.


Abstract

“While calls to integrate ethics into computer science education go back decades, recent high-profile ethical failures related to computing technology by large technology companies, governments, and academic institutions have accelerated the adoption of computer ethics education at all levels of instruction. Discussions of how to integrate ethics into existing computer science programmes often focus on the structure of the intervention—embedded modules or dedicated courses, humanists or computer scientists as ethics instructors—or on the specific content to be included—lists of case studies and essential topics to cover. While proponents of computer ethics education often emphasize the importance of closely connecting ethical and technical content in these initiatives, most do not reflect in depth on the variety of ways in which the disciplines can be combined. In this paper, I deploy a framework from crossdisciplinary studies that categorizes academic projects that work across disciplines as multidisciplinary, interdisciplinary, or transdisciplinary, depending on the degree of integration. When applied to computer ethics education, this framework is orthogonal to the structure and content of the initiative, as I illustrate using examples of dedicated ethics courses and embedded modules. It therefore highlights additional features of cross-disciplinary teaching that need to be considered when planning a computer ethics programme. I argue that computer ethics education should aim to be at least interdisciplinary—multidisciplinary initiatives are less aligned with the pedagogical aims of computer ethics—and that computer ethics educators should experiment with fully transdisciplinary education that could transform computer science as a whole for the better.”


Author Keywords

Ethics education, embedded ethics, data justice, ethics course, higher education, cross-disciplinary studies, interdisciplinary teaching and learning, responsible computing, transdisciplinary studies, interdisciplinary studies


My One Sentence Summary

This article unpacks three approaches to integrating ethics with computer science education.


Some Of My Lingering Questions/Thoughts

  • How might we communicate and develop shared understandings of the integration of computer science and ethics?

  • What other frameworks might we utilize when exploring the intersections of computer science and ethics?

  • When is there too little/much of ethics in CS?


Resources/Links Relevant to This Episode



More Content